Product Description
The CMPWR161 is a micropower, low noise regulator
designed specifically to filter out noise from a 5V digital
supply making it ideal for noise-sensitive analog appli-
cations. The CMPWR161 delivers up to 150mA at a
fixed 4.75V output. A bandgap reference bypass pin
(BYP) provides low noise operation when an external
capacitor is connected between this pin and ground. In
addition, the CMPWR161 features an enable pin (EN)
which allows the regulator to be placed into shutdown
mode supporting low power and battery applications.
The CMOS regulator features low quiescent current
even at full load.
The CMPWR161 is housed in a 5-pin SOT-23 package,
which is ideal for space critical applications. It is avail-
able with optional lead-free finishing.

PIN DESCRIPTIONS
PIN
1
NAME
V
IN
DESCRIPTION
Positive input voltage for the regulator. The internal loading on this input is typically 300µA when-
ever the regulator is enabled and less than 1µA when the regulator is disabled. If this input is
greater than 2 inches from the main input filter, a 1µF ceramic capacitor is recommended for addi-
tional filtering.
The negative reference for all voltages.
Enable/shutdown input. When EN is asserted high (V
EN
≥
2V), the regulator is enabled. When EN
is asserted low, the regulator is shutdown (V
OUT
=0V). This input is compatible with CMOS logic.
Reference bypass pin. This input is used to connect an external capacitor (C
BYP
) for noise reduc-
tion and to maximize power supply ripple rejection. A 10nF capacitor is recommended for this func-
tion.
The regulated voltage output. An output capacitor of 10µF is recommended to provide the neces-
sary phase compensation for the regulator and also minimize any transient disturbances.
